Does South Carolina Have Online Sports Betting?

South Carolina is one of the few states in the US that does not have any form of legal sports betting, including online sports betting. As of now, there are no laws in place that allow for online sports betting within the state. This means that residents of South Carolina cannot legally place bets on sports events through online platforms.

While some states have embraced the legalization of sports betting, South Carolina has been more conservative in its approach. The state has not shown any signs of changing its stance on sports betting, either online or in-person. This has left many sports fans in South Carolina frustrated, as they are unable to participate in this popular form of gambling.

Despite the lack of legal online sports betting options in South Carolina, some residents may still choose to place bets through offshore gambling websites. These websites operate outside of US jurisdiction and are not subject to the same regulations as domestic sportsbooks. However, it is important to note that using these offshore sites carries inherent risks, as there is no guarantee of the safety or security of your funds.
